Regarding supply cap:

I found that when playing as the Union I could get at least my 1st corps (I forget what was the case with my 2nd) up to 70,000 supply, and any value over 35,000 would give a second wagon.  When playing as the Confederacy all corps were limited to 35,000 and 1 wagon.  If a consistent feature this may make some sense, considering the sides' supply capabilities in real life.

Can anyone with authority give a definite answer?

Link to comment
Share on other sites

I checked my saves and before Shiloh I could only put a maximum of 35,000 supplies in my 2 Corps. After Shiloh, I was able to get 1st Corps up to 35,000 and 2nd Corps up to 70,000.

I tried bringing up 2nd Corps first, as 1st Corps was less than 35,000, thinking that perhaps the first Corps to reach 35,000 was capped. But no, 2nd Corps went right past 35,000 and when I went to 1st Corps once again it would go no higher than 35,000.

I checked before Gaines Mill, when I had a 3rd Corps and it was also capped at 35,000 and in a later save when I had a 4th Corps it was also capped at 35,000.

So overall, for some reason, 3 of my Corps were capped at 35,000 supply and 2nd Corps could take up to 70,000 supplies.

Thus the reason why I recommended using 2nd Corps as the spearhead as I could bring 2 supply wagons and a great deal more than 35,000 supply.

Give it another shot. Took me 2 shots at it to win as the Union. The difference between the two campaigns was how I spent my career points. When I won first I max'ed out medicine, then Economy, followed by Training and lastly I maxed out Politics. Like the real war, your problem isn't men and money. You problem is poor recruits that you need to turn into veterans (medicine) that you need to arm with the best weapons possible (economy).
